Basically we don't have any in place due to the old SLT guard. They aren't here anymore. We have 2 members of staff who both have over 90GB's in their home area. 1 is backs ups of backs up, We'll solve that by enabling file duplication. The other has over 80GB's of youtube downloads ( I know, we are sorting that too)

 

What I would like to know is for staff what do you set? (I know it'll depend on your storage capacity and users) We have 3.25TB's of storage (on site) I am thinking around 20GB per staff member. Then my next question is students. What do you have in place for them? Do you do it like this for example :-

 

Year 7 > 500mb

Year 8 > 1GB

Year 9 > 1.5GB

Year 10 > 2 GB

Year 11 > 2.5 GB

 

or something else? I know years 10 & 11 will need more. Any advise would be greatly appreciated.

We have staff on 50gig, and students on 6gig (10 for photography). - If they fill it up they'll delete stuff, we don't increase per year :p

 

With reduplication enabled it's much less of an issue nowadays really, always those that will push it, but we only have about 3 staff anywhere near the 50 limit rest are up to about 25~ average :p

KS3 get 1GB

KS4 get 2GB

Sixth form get 5GB (or up to 20GB for photography)

Staff are unlimited

 

Though we're just about to start a migration to Office 365 and moving to Onedrive for storage, so everyone will have at least 1TB each. We'll be keeping massive users like reprographics and media locally though.

"Unlimited" we just add more disks to the SAN and Backup each year (if we need to)

 

We purge silly stuff from time to time if we look like we are running low.

 

We've had this policy since 2006. Backup is 36TB for everything. Average student home folder is 1.7Gb. Obviously Media and Photography students (of which we have a lot) skew that with typical folder sizes of 10Gb. Staff average at 11GB, again skewed by media and photography teachers, and a couple of HoDs who will have copies of the departmental shares for accessing offline.

Staff - 5GB

Student - 1GB

 

If that isn't enough they have unlimited storage in Google Drive. It will all be located in there anyway soon.

We start with 4G for staff and 2g for students...but increase as and when we get requests and the longer they stately in school some staff have 20gb or more...technology....but students are within 6gb even by 6th form. With enterprise onedrive which no longer syncs folders we hope to make better use of cloud storage.
